Romero City is by far the largest and most-populous city in Mishigimaa, with well over half a million inhabitants, and its wider metropolitan area having almost five million.
The city is known as a major cultural centre, known for its contributions to music, art, and architecture. It's also a major port, connecting to the Grand Lakes via the Romero Strait, and sits on the border with Northland. It is also, of course, a major economic hub, in particular the financial, medical and technology sectors.
Politically, it tends to lean slightly Democrat.

Spearing is the capital of Mishigimaa, but the third largest city after Romero and Grand Rapids. As the capital, the city is home to the State House and the State Police HQ (as well as the Governor's personal residence), making it a key location for coordinating state issues. In addition, due to its political and economic significance, all three major corporations have an office in the city.
The city is notable for having a number of significant educational institutions, including medical schools, law schools, and Mishigimaa State University.
Politically, it tends to lean slightly Republican.

Bay City is a smaller city with fewer than 50,000 residents, sitting close to the coast of the Grand Lakes that separate Mishigimaa from Northland. It's most distinguishing feature is the Sagong river, that effectively bisects the city into two halves, with travel allowed by four bascule drawbridges.
The city is well known for its numerous festivals and celebrations, especially during the summer months.
Politically, it tends to lean fairly Republican.

Grand Rapids is the second largest city in Mishigimaa, with over 200,000 residents. Historically, it is known for being a major lumber and furniture producer, though today it has a very diverse economy.
It is the economic and cultural hub of western Mishigimaa, and one of the fastest growing cities in the tri-state region.
Politically, it tends to lean fairly Democrat.

Mishigimaa is a state in the Central-North of the country, bordering Northland and the Grand Lakes.
It is one of the more populated states, with a reasonably well-developed economy, though it has slipped down the rankings slowly over the last decade.
Whilst the bulk of its economy is manufacturing, forestry, agriculture and services, Mishigimaa is one of the highest ranking states in the country for high-tech and R&D companies, with over half a million workers in these sectors.
Politically, it tends to lean slightly Republican.
